CLARITY Act: Senate Banking Republicans Yet to Secure Full Support Ahead Markup

In the latest CLARITY Act update, Senate Banking Republicans have yet to secure full support from all Republicans on the Committee, which is necessary as they look to at least advance the crypto bill along party lines. Senate Banking Committee Chair Tim Scott expressed optimism that he could soon secure full Republican support and that they could mark up the crypto bill in May.  Full Republican Support Still Missing Ahead of Potential CLARITY Act Markup  According to a Punchbowl report, Senate Banking Republicans have yet to secure full support from all Republicans on the Committee as they look to advance the crypto bill. The report highlighted Senator John Kennedy as one of the members of the Committee who continues to withhold their support for the bill.  This development comes as Senator Thom Tillis, who appeared to be a holdout among the Republicans, pushes for a CLARITY Act markup. Tillis said that he will ask Senator Scott to schedule a markup for the crypto bill once they return from their May recess.  However, full Republican support is key, especially as the Senate Banking Republicans may need to advance the crypto bill along party lines. Ripple Bets Big on UAE Growth with New DIFC Headquarters

Merrick added, “A larger team, based here in Dubai, will enable us to go further in supporting our clients and partners across the region and beyond.”  He further said that since the companys early days in the UAE, it has witnessed strong demand from local businesses for regulated, blockchain-based payment infrastructure. As this demand continues to grow, the payments company intends to bolster its presence in the region.  Middle East Becomes Key Growth Market  It is worth noting that favorable conditions in the UAE are a major factor in the latest Ripple news. Notably, Ripple initially launched its MEA headquarters in Dubai in 2020. Now, the Middle East accounts for a significant part of Ripples global customer base. This shows how quickly demand for blockchain-based financial solutions is rising in the region.  The companys new office at the Dubai International Financial Center (DIFC) reflects this strong growth. It also gives Ripple more space to expand its regional team, with plans to double its workforce in the coming period.  This expansion is aimed at strengthening support for clients and partners across the Middle East and Africa, including well-known names such as Zand Bank, Ctrl Alt, Garanti BBVA, Absa Bank, and Chipper Cash. Pricey NFL, NBA ownership stakes push investors to smaller leagues

Trinity Rodman #2 of Washington Spirit evades Sarah Schupansky #11 of Gotham FC during the NWSL Championship 2025 final between Washington Spirit and NJ/NY Gotham FC at PayPal Park on November 22, 2025 in San Jose, California.  Lyndsay Radnedge/isi Photos | Isi Photos | Getty Images  Last week, the National Womens Soccer League awarded a new expansion franchise — in Columbus, Ohio — to an ownership group led by Haslam Sports Group for a fee of $205 million.  This represents a $40 million jump from the $165 million that billionaire Arthur Blank reportedly paid for the leagues Atlanta franchise in November. And that $165 million itself was a jump of $55 million from the reported $110 million fee Denver paid in January of last year.  Rewind to 2022, and the expansion fee for a new NWSL club was just $2 million.  On the surface, this appears to be a story about the NWSLs growth. Postseason attendance rose 11% this past season, according to the league. Nearly 1.2 million people watched the NWSL finals, up 22% from a year ago, including a whopping 70% jump in the 18-to-34 demographic, the NWSL said. Anchorage Digital and M0 team up to power next wave of regulated stablecoins

Anchorage Digital, the U.S first federally chartered crypto bank, has tapped M0 as its core technology provider, a move designed to turn the custodian into a primary engine for institutions looking to mint and manage regulated stablecoins.  San Francisico-based Anchorage seeks to expand its issuance platform through M0, and opens the door to a broad range of firms looking to launch U.S.-regulated stablecoins, according to a press release.  M0 (pronounced “M Zero”), is a flexible protocol that allows global institutions to mint fully configurable stablecoins, which also works with the likes of Stripe, Moonpay and MetaMask.  “It might not sound like the sexiest topic, but we have been building modular infrastructure for stablecoins for three years now,” said M0 CEO Luca Prosperi, in an interview. “This means we are supporting anyone who wants to launch and manage their own stablecoin, whether it is a crypto project, protocol, fintech, payment provider, exchange and many more.”  The arrival of the GENIUS Act means stablecoins in the U.S. are becoming a regulated instrument. Hoskinson Slams Ripple CEO Over CLARITY Act Bias

Hoskinson Sparks Firestorm Over CLARITY Act, Hints at Hidden Winners and Losers in Crypto Regulation Debate  Crypto policy tensions are heating up again, as Cardano founder Charles Hoskinson ignites fresh debate with pointed remarks widely seen as a direct challenge to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se and growing momentum behind the CLARITY Act.  As market analyst Diana noted, Charles Hoskinson used a recent to challenge how crypto regulations are being crafted, and who they truly serve.  Addressing the CLARITY Act, he warned that while the bill promises structure, it could ultimately tilt the playing field toward established players, leaving emerging blockchain projects struggling to compete.  Charles Hoskinson pointed out that theyre missing the bigger picture because under stricter interpretations, assets like Ethereum, XRP, and Cardano (ADA) could all be classified as securities.  He argued that much of cryptos early growth was fueled by regulatory gray areas, which gave leading networks time to expand and entrench themselves. Now, as rules tighten, he warns the shift could cement those early advantages, raising the barrier for newer projects trying to compete. ECB signals growing rate hike inclination as Lagarde stresses rising risks

Polymarket partners with Chainalysis to deploy on-chain surveillance targeting insider trading and manipulation as volumes hit $7B monthly and regulation intensifies.ECB kept rates unchanged at April 30 meeting but signaled potential June rate hikeLagarde emphasized intensifying risks to both inflation and economic growthMarkets pricing approximately 50 basis points of tightening by year-end  The European Central Bank maintained interest rates unchanged at its April 30 meeting, but ECB President Christine Lagardes press conference remarks indicated a June rate hike has moved closer to reality, according to ING analyst Carsten Brzeski. Lagarde stressed that risks on both growth and inflation are intensifying, though the decision to keep rates steady was unanimous.  Brzeski noted the ECB has introduced a clear inclination towards rate hikes within its wait-and-see stance. Markets currently price approximately 50 basis points of tightening by year-end, with between 20 and 40 basis points anticipated by June.  Inflation Risks Tilt Upward  The ECB baseline projections see headline inflation averaging 2.6% in 2026, 2.0% in 2027 and 2.1% in 2028, revised higher from December primarily due to energy price pressures from the Iran war.
